What Should I Put Behind Me On Zoom?

In summary: try not sit with your back to a bright window, and if you do have a window behind you, diffuse any bright sunlight and add additional lighting on your face. natural light is great but don’t be afraid to artificially enhance your lighting (with a ring light or similar) add lights to your background as well.

What do you put in background Zoom?

Background video

  1. A MP4 or MOV video file.
  2. Minimum resolution of 480 by 360 pixels (360p) and a maximum resolution of 1920 by 1080 pixels (1080p).

What makes a good virtual background?

To achieve the best virtual background effect, Zoom recommends using a high-contrast, solid-color backdrop, preferably a green screen (Amazon has a good selection). Whatever you use, go for a matt, non-reflective background.

What is the best background color for Zoom?

When it comes to selecting the best background color for video conferencing, flashy patterns and stark colors should be avoided. Bright colors like yellow, orange, or red can be unflattering and distracting. Neutral tones, like navy blue, light gray, and soft white, appear best on video and are easy on the eyes.

Is it better to have a light or dark background on Zoom?

Stay Cool Get rid of any bright light behind you, such as open windows looking into the sun. Use a neutral or dark background wall to give a more balanced, serene impression. When you appear darker than your surroundings viewers are likely to focus on the background, not on you.

How do you Zoom not look like a ghost?

More light is almost always better than less for this kind of stuff, just make sure it’s not behind you! Solution: Make sure the primary light source is in front of your face and behind the computer camera. Do not sit in front of a giant window, or significant light source. This will cause your face to be underexposed.

Why does Zoom background cover my face?

That’s because ‘Zooming’ in a darker space generally forces your webcam to overexpose your face while trying to bring out more detail in the background of your shot. So then, when you’re forced to lower the lighting on your face to fix the problem, you end up sitting mostly in the dark.

What colors should you not wear on Zoom?

Avoid off-whites, light blue, pale pink, and ivory because they often appear white on camera. “No black!” Or… other very dark colors. Black, navy, dark grey, dark burgundy, most brown shades will appear as black.

How long can a zoom video background be?

Length: Less than 30 seconds.
While Zoom does not specify a length requirement, most video backgrounds should be no longer than 30 seconds to avoid becoming a distraction during calls. Longer video files will also be too large to use as a background.

What can I use instead of a green screen?

Green screen alternative: Green Matte Paint. Green matte paint is the perfect alternative for a permanent solution. You can easily pick up a can of paint for $6-20 at any DIY store. Just ensure that you have the owner of the property’s permission before you begin painting.
